Na konci tohoto návodu budete schopni efektivně ovládat Claude Code CLI a provádět komplexní úkoly bez nutnosti psát složitý kód. Tento přístup minimalizuje časovou náročnost a snižuje chybovost, což zvyšuje produktivitu a stabilitu vývojových procesů.
Pro ilustraci metodiky použijeme scénář softwarového týmu, který integruje Claude Code CLI do svých automatizačních rutin. Každý krok bude aplikován na tento příklad, aby bylo možné jasně sledovat praktickou implementaci a dosažení optimálních výsledků.
Obsah článku
- Co je Claude Code Cli a proč jej ovládnout
- Příprava prostředí pro efektivní práci s Claude Code cli
- Instalace a základní konfigurace Claude Code cli
- Vytváření a správa projektů bez složitého kódu
- Automatizace úloh pomocí předpřipravených příkazů
- Optimalizace workflow pro maximální efektivitu
- Testování a ladění výsledků v Claude Code Cli
- Měření úspěšnosti a průběžná kontrola výkonu
- otázky a odpovědi
- Jak řešit problémy s kompatibilitou Claude Code Cli na různých operačních systémech?
- Co je hlavní rozdíl mezi Claude Code Cli a jinými AI CLI nástroji, jako je GitHub Copilot?
- Proč může být omezený přístup k webovým zdrojům v Claude Code problematický a jak to řešit?
- Jak často by měla probíhat aktualizace Skills v Claude Code pro udržení maximální efektivity?
- Je lepší používat Claude Code 3.7 Sonnet nebo novější verze pro sofistikované programování?
- Klíčové Poznatky
Co je Claude Code Cli a proč jej ovládnout
Tato část vysvětluje, co je Claude Code Cli a proč je klíčové jej ovládnout pro efektivní práci s Claude Code. Po předchozím kroku instalace a základního nastavení se nyní naučíte pracovat s příkazovým rozhraním, které výrazně zefektivní váš vývojový proces.
Claude Code Cli představuje nástroj příkazového řádku určený k řízení modelů Claude bez potřeby složitého kódování.Umožňuje rychlé zadávání úloh, správu projektů a integraci do automatizačních skriptů, což snižuje čas potřebný k implementaci řešení.
Použijte následující postup pro ovládnutí základních funkcí:
- Nastavte autentizaci pomocí API klíče.
- Inicializujte nový projekt pomocí příkazu `claude init`.
- zadávejte kódové dotazy nebo testujte model přes CLI.
⚠️ Common Mistake: Mnozí uživatelé zapomínají správně nastavit autentizační token, což vede k chybám při volání API. Před spuštěním vždy ověřte platnost klíče.
Pro ilustraci si představme tým vyvíjející interní nástroj pro automatické generování dokumentace. použitím claude Code cli mohou okamžitě spustit skripty na generování textu a validaci výsledků bez nutnosti přepínat mezi rozhraními. To významně šetří čas a snižuje chyby v pracovní rutině.
Doporučujeme jako nejefektivnější přístup využití CLI v kombinaci s konfigurací souboru claude.md pro definování jasných pravidel projektu.Tato metoda zajišťuje konzistenci výsledků a minimalizuje potřebu opakovaných zásahů během vývoje[[7](https://www.zhihu.com/question/1979609139266213083)].
Příprava prostředí pro efektivní práci s Claude Code cli
zajistí stabilitu a rychlost vývoje bez nutnosti složitého kódování. Navazuje na předchozí krok,kdy uživatel získal základní přehled o funkcionalitách nástroje.Nyní nastavíme základní komponenty a konfigurace potřebné pro plynulý běh.
Nejprve nainstalujte příslušné závislosti, zejména Python 3.10+ a správce balíčků pip. Doporučuje se vytvořit izolované virtuální prostředí (venv), které zabrání konfliktům verzí při správě knihoven. Tento krok zajišťuje předvídatelné výsledky během používání CLI nástroje.
- Spusťte příkaz
python3 -m venv claude-envpro vytvoření virtuálního prostředí. - Aktivujte vytvořené prostředí příkazem
source claude-env/bin/activate(Linux/Mac) neboclaude-envScriptsactivate.bat(Windows). - Nainstalujte požadované balíčky přes
pip install -r requirements.txt, kde soubor obsahuje přesné verze závislostí kompatibilních s Claude Code Cli.
⚠️ Common Mistake: Mnozí opomíjejí aktivaci virtuálního prostředí, což vede k instalaci balíčků globálně a pozdějším konfliktům verzí. Vždy aktivujte venv před instalací.
Dále doporučujeme nastavit proměnné prostředí, které Claude Code Cli vyžaduje pro autentizaci a konfiguraci. V našem příkladu specifikujeme token API pomocí: export CLAUDE_API_TOKEN="váš_token". Tato praxe zabezpečí bezpečný přenos citlivých údajů mimo kód.
Posledním krokem je ověření funkčnosti prostředí spuštěním základního příkazu CLI, například claude status. Pokud výstup potvrdí aktivní spojení a korektní konfiguraci, prostředí je připravené.
Example: Po aktivaci venv a nastavení tokenu stojící tým provede příkaz
claude generate --prompt "Vytvoř text bez složitostí", který generuje výsledek bez potřeby psaní komplexního kódu.
Instalace a základní konfigurace Claude Code cli
V této fázi dosáhnete , což navazuje na předchozí přípravu prostředí. pro efektivní využití se doporučuje nejprve stáhnout oficiální balíček z autorizovaného repozitáře,který garantuje kompatibilitu a bezpečnost.
Následujte tyto kroky pro instalaci:
- Stáhněte instalační soubor vhodný pro váš operační systém z oficiálních stránek.
- Spusťte instalační příkaz v terminálu, například:
sudo apt-get install claude-clina Linuxu nebo ekvivalent na Windows/macOS. - Ověřte instalaci zadáním příkazu
claude --version, který by měl vrátit aktuální verzi nástroje.
Dále nastavte základní konfiguraci specifickou pro vaše projektové prostředí. Upravte konfigurační soubor (např. .clauderconfig) následujícím způsobem:
- Zadejte API klíč,který získáte z uživatelského rozhraní Claude platformy.
- Definujte výchozí pracovní adresář pro ukládání generovaného kódu.
- Nastavte požadovaný režim běhu – například interaktivní nebo skriptový.
⚠️ Common Mistake: Častou chybou je opomenutí zadání správného API klíče v konfiguračním souboru. To vede k neúspěšnému připojení k serveru a selhání spuštění CLI. Vždy ověřte platnost a přesnost klíče před zahájením práce.
Example: Po instalaci Claude Code Cli bude příkaz
claude --initvytvoří konfigurační soubor automaticky s vyžádaným API klíčem a nastavením pracovního adresáře např./home/uzivatel/claude_workspace.
Tato metoda představuje nejefektivnější způsob instalace díky minimalizaci chyb při nasazení a rychlému zahájení práce. Konzistentní používání oficiálních zdrojů a standardních příkazů výrazně snižuje riziko nekompatibility či bezpečnostních incidentů.
Vytváření a správa projektů bez složitého kódu
V této fázi nastavíte strukturu projektu v rámci Claude Code CLI tak,aby vyhovovala potřebám bez nutnosti složitého kódování.Navazuje to na předchozí krok, kde jste připravili základní prostředí; nyní vytvoříte a spravujete projekt přes definici klíčových parametrů v přehledném formátu konfiguračního souboru.
Postupujte takto:
- Inicializujte nový projekt příkazem `claude create project –name „MarketingAnalysis“ –template basic`.
- Upravte vytvořený `claude.md` soubor tak, aby obsahoval jasné popisy cílů, omezení a použitých modelů.
- Spravujte závislosti skrze integrované Skills moduly, které lze snadno přidávat nebo odebírat bez psaní kódu.
Použití souboru `claude.md` jako konsensuálního základu umožňuje modelu správně interpretovat projektové preference a automaticky aplikovat pravidla během celé práce [[1]](https://www.zhihu.com/question/1979609139266213083). Toto eliminuje potřebu manuálního kódování logiky pro každý úkol.
⚠️ Common Mistake: Často se opomíjí aktualizace `claude.md` po změnách v projektu. Vždy synchronizujte tento soubor s aktuálním stavem, jinak může Claude nesprávně interpretovat požadavky.
Pro běžný příklad marketingové analýzy nastavte ve `claude.md` parametry pro datové zdroje, metriky a zákaznické segmenty. Nevyžaduje to psaní skriptů, jen declarativní zápis preferencí. To umožňuje efektivní řízení projektu bez zbytečné komplexity a podporuje automatizované rozhodování v Claude Code CLI.
Example: Soubor `claude.md` uvádí: „Projekt analyzuje dopad kampaně na základě metrik CTR a CPA; model bude filtrovat data podle regionu EU.“ Tento jednoduchý popis stačí k nastavení celého workflow bez programování.
Tento přístup je nejefektivnější pro týmy, které chtějí škálovat práci s Claude Code bez potřeby odborníků na kódování.Evidence ukazuje, že využití konfiguračních souborů zvyšuje rychlost nasazení o 30 % oproti tradičnímu manuálnímu psaní skriptů ve stejném rozsahu [[6]](https://www.zhihu.com/question/1988477212043793215).
Automatizace úloh pomocí předpřipravených příkazů
Tento krok umožňuje automatizovat rutinní úlohy pomocí předpřipravených příkazů, které navazují na předchozí konfiguraci nástroje Claude Code CLI. Uživatel tak přechází z manuálního zadávání komplexních příkazů k využití šablon, což výrazně zvyšuje efektivitu práce.
Pro začátek definujte ve svém projektu sadu opakujících se příkazů jako aliasy nebo skripty. V našem běžícím příkladu stanovte příkaz pro automatické generování reportu z datového souboru bez dalšího psaní parametrů. Postupujte takto:
- Vytvořte konfigurační soubor s názvem „commands.yaml“.
- definujte nový příkaz „report-generate“ s parametry odpovídající datovému souboru.
- Uložte a načtěte konfiguraci do Claude Code CLI.
⚠️ Common mistake: Častou chybou je nesprávné mapování parametrů v předpřipravených příkazech. Ověřte vždy správnost syntaxe a odpovídající hodnoty, aby nedošlo k chybnému spuštění úlohy.
Použitím této metody v našem příkladu spustíte jednoduchý příkaz „claude report-generate“, který interně použije všechny potřebné argumenty. Tím se minimalizuje riziko chyb a zkracuje čas na přípravu úloh.
Example: Spuštění příkazu „claude report-generate“ automaticky načte data ze souboru „data.csv“ a vygeneruje kompletní analýzu bez další interakce uživatele.
Tato metoda je nejúčinnější díky konzistenci a opakovatelnosti výsledků.Firmy, které implementují tento přístup, zaznamenávají až dvojnásobné zvýšení produktivity při správě datových procesů oproti manuálnímu zadávání příkazů.
Optimalizace workflow pro maximální efektivitu
Optimalizace workflow navazuje na předchozí kroky a umožňuje maximalizovat efektivitu při práci s Claude Code CLI. V tomto kroku nastavte automatizaci opakovatelných úloh a minimalizujte manuální zásahy, čímž snížíte riziko chyb a zrychlíte celý proces.Postupujte takto:
- Definujte jasné skripty pro běžné příkazy, například build a deploy, abyste eliminovali ruční zadávání.
- Nastavte integraci s verzovacím systémem pro automatické spouštění testů při každém commitu.
- Implementujte logování chyb pro rychlou detekci a řešení problémů v reálném čase.
⚠️ Common Mistake: Uživatele často selhávají v nastavení pravidelné aktualizace skriptů. Místo toho, aby přizpůsobili workflow změnám v projektu, zachovávají statické postupy, které vedou ke zpomalení a zvýšenému počtu chyb.
Konkrétní příklad optimalizace ve firemním prostředí s Claude Code CLI je automatizovaná sestava zdrojového kódu následovaná jeho nasazením do testovacího prostředí. Tato sekvence eliminuje potřebu manuálního spouštění jednotlivých kroků a výrazně zkracuje dobu odezvy vývojového týmu na nové požadavky.
example: Vývojový tým využívá skript „deploy-test“, který jedním příkazem spustí kompilaci, testování a nasazení do stagingu bez dalšího zásahu.
Pro dlouhodobý úspěch doporučuji využít centralizované monitorování workflow, které poskytne data o výkonnosti jednotlivých kroků.Řízená analýza těchto dat umožní identifikovat úzká místa a implementovat cílené zlepšení s konkrétním dopadem na produktivitu.
Testování a ladění výsledků v Claude Code Cli
je zásadní pro ověření správnosti předchozích kroků.Tento proces navazuje na konfiguraci a spuštění příkazů, kde zkontrolujete, zda výstup odpovídá očekávanému formátu a funkcionalitě definované v předchozích fázích.
Postupujte podle těchto kroků pro efektivní testování vašeho běžného příkladu:
- Spusťte příkaz s parametry nastavenými v předchozím kroku.
- Porovnejte výstup s očekávaným výsledkem, který by měl obsahovat přesné strukturování a správnou syntaxi.
- identifikujte odchylky nebo chyby ve výstupu a zaznamenejte je pro následné ladění.
Při našem běžném příkladu nastavte vstup tak, aby generoval výstupy s přesným blokovým formátováním a obsahoval všechny klíčové informace bez redundantních dat. Výsledek by měl být konzistentní mezi jednotlivými spuštěními.
Example: Příkaz „claude code run –input example.txt“ produkuje čistý JSON výstup s validní strukturou bez chybných polí či prázdných hodnot.
⚠️ Common Mistake: Častou chybou je testování pouze jednorázově bez opakovaných běhů, což může maskovat nestabilní chování výsledků. Vždy proveďte minimálně tři opakované testy za různých podmínek.
Pro ladění použijte vestavěné možnosti Claude Code Cli k podrobnému logování a ladicím režimům:
- Přepínač „–verbose“ pro detailnější výstup během provozu.
- Ladicí flag „–debug“ odhalující interní chyby a nečekané stavové kódy.
tyto nástroje umožňují rychlou identifikaci problémových míst bez nutnosti externích debuggerů.
Doporučený přístup k ladění spočívá v úpravě vstupních parametrů na základě zpětné vazby z testovacích běhů. Pro náš příklad upravte timeouty či množství zpracovávaných dat postupně do okamžiku, kdy se výstupy stabilizují dle specifikace. Tento systematický proces minimalizuje riziko chybných nebo neúplných dat ve finálním nasazení.
Měření úspěšnosti a průběžná kontrola výkonu
V této fázi se zaměříte na měření úspěšnosti a průběžnou kontrolu výkonu, což navazuje na předchozí kroky implementace Claude Code CLI. Účelem je systematicky vyhodnocovat výsledky a zajistit, že nástroj plní stanovené cíle efektivity bez nutnosti složitých zásahů do kódu.
Nastavte metriky výkonu jako základ pro kvantitativní hodnocení. Doporučuje se sledovat čas odezvy CLI, počet úspěšně zpracovaných příkazů a míru chybovosti. Pro příklad: pokud používáte Claude Code CLI ke generování reportů, měřte průměrnou dobu generování jednoho reportu a procento neúspěšných pokusů.
- definujte klíčové indikátory výkonu (KPI) relevantní pro váš use-case.
- Implementujte logování aktivit a výsledků příkazů pro zpětnou analýzu.
- Nastavte automatizované alarmy při překročení definovaných limitů chyb nebo prodlev.
⚠️ Common Mistake: Mnoho uživatelů ignoruje nastavení pravidelných auditů výkonu, což vede k zpoždění při odhalování kritických chyb. Místo toho implementujte kontinuální monitorování s jasně definovanými intervaly kontroly.
Praktický příklad měření u našeho běžného scénáře: sledujte denní přehled statistik o využití CLI pomocí skriptu, který extrahuje logy a generuje report o počtu spuštění, průměrné době a počtu chyb. Tímto způsobem lze snadno identifikovat výkyvy ve výkonu a reagovat včas.
Example: Skript vykazující 97 % úspěšnost příkazů a průměrnou dobu odezvy 2,5 sekundy za poslední týden indikuje stabilní provoz bez nutnosti zásahu.
Konečně je nezbytné zavést mechanismus zpětné vazby od uživatelů CLI. Kvantitativní data doplňujte kvalitativním hodnocením uživatelského zážitku, což umožní optimalizaci workflow bez nutnosti přepisování složitého kódu. Tento víceúrovňový přístup garantuje dlouhodobou efektivitu nástroje.
otázky a odpovědi
Jak řešit problémy s kompatibilitou Claude Code Cli na různých operačních systémech?
Claude Code Cli je kompatibilní s hlavními operačními systémy, ale mohou nastat specifické konflikty. Nejčastější příčinou problémů jsou chybějící závislosti nebo rozdíly ve verzích prostředí; doporučuje se používat oficiální instalační skripty a pravidelně aktualizovat software.[1]
Co je hlavní rozdíl mezi Claude Code Cli a jinými AI CLI nástroji, jako je GitHub Copilot?
Claude Code Cli vyniká díky integrovanému ekosystému Skills, což zvyšuje jeho flexibilitu a použitelnost. Tento přístup umožňuje využít tisíce předdefinovaných funkcí, které výrazně ulehčují složité úkoly oproti GitHub Copilot, jenž je zaměřen spíše na psaní kódu než na komplexní workflow.[8]
Proč může být omezený přístup k webovým zdrojům v Claude Code problematický a jak to řešit?
Omezený přístup k webovým zdrojům způsobuje nedostatek aktuálních dat pro analýzu v Claude Code. Pro efektivní získávání informací se doporučuje integrovat domácí velké modely nebo alternativní API služby, které zajistí stabilnější přívod externích dat.[9]
Jak často by měla probíhat aktualizace Skills v Claude Code pro udržení maximální efektivity?
Skills by měly být aktualizovány pravidelně, ideálně během každého většího projektu nebo měsíčně. Pravidelná aktualizace zabezpečuje využití nejnovějších funkcionalit a oprav chyb, což významně ovlivňuje rychlost a kvalitu automatizovaných procesů.[1]
Je lepší používat Claude Code 3.7 Sonnet nebo novější verze pro sofistikované programování?
Claude Code 3.7 Sonnet je stále výkonný, ale novější verze nabízí lepší multimodální schopnosti a přesnější korekce. Výběr závisí na konkrétním požadavku: pokud jde o pokročilé analýzy a vícezdrojové vstupy,novější verze jsou vhodnější díky rozšířeným funkcím.[3]
Klíčové Poznatky
Po dokončení všech kroků je běžný uživatel schopen efektivně využívat Claude Code CLI bez potřeby psát komplexní kód, čímž se zrychluje vývoj a minimalizují chyby v nasazení. Příklad ukazuje jasnou aplikovatelnost této metody, která zjednodušuje interakce s API a zlepšuje pracovní postupy v reálných scénářích.
Nyní je na pořadu dne přenést tento systematický přístup do vlastních projektů. organizace, které integrují tyto principy, získávají konkurenční výhodu díky efektivitě a spolehlivosti implementací.





